Things haven’t been looking good for Kodak Black. The 19 year old was supposed to be released last week after pleading no contest and sentenced to community service and take part in a drug program after facing false imprisonment, robbery without a weapon charges, and several other charges. However, his release was put on hold after the court found two warrants out on the Florida native during processing in which one of the warrants contained a no bond hold.

Unfortunately, things aren’t getting any easier for Kodak as it was just revealed that he has been accused of sexual battery in South Carolina. According to The FADER, the platform took out a freedom of information request and received an email back from the Florence County Sheriff’s Office, where they confirmed that the outstanding warrant for Kodak Black in South Carolina was for sexual battery.

According to they email, they wrote:

On or about February 7, 2016 Octave is alleged to have engaged in the sexual battery of the victim at a hotel located at 2120 West Lucas Street, Florence, SC

Major Michael M. Nunn, the General Counsel/P.I.O. for the Florence County Sheriff’s Office told THE FADER in a phone call this morning that the rapper will be transported to Florence County for an arraignment and bond hearing.

With this charge now coming into play, Kodak Black may be facing up to thirty years in prison.
